- Albero_I_of_Louvain comment "Albero I of Louvain (1070 – 1 January 1128) was the 57th Prince-Bishop of Liège from 1123 until his death.Albero was the third son of Henry II, Count of Leuven and Adela of Tweisterbant.After the suspicious death of Prince-Bishop Frederick of Liege in 1121, Holy Roman Emperor Henry V appointed Alexander of Jülich as his successor.".
